Output 751e6afaad7ae2c2d23c19efa18feb2b59942dcb0348bdb54e7f3aab8a81f513:1

value
223517438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1fb35fe30b422d7072d2131b60cb98c5ffc7944 OP_EQUAL
address
3LqJ65P21ysBkMPbabHqTpFMmAUAyGwCAU
transaction
751e6afaad7ae2c2d23c19efa18feb2b59942dcb0348bdb54e7f3aab8a81f513
confirmations
199854
spent
true